Returning to trucking by Spiritual-Winter6557 in uktrucking

[–]OddClub4097 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I don’t tramp anymore, but a camp stove or some way to cook, unless you’re cab already has a microwave. I see a lot of people take air fryers nowadays. One fella on YouTube has a Bluetti powerstion he runs everything off. Also I’d like to think if you’re tramping the truck would already have a fridge, but if not you’ll need one. Also a fan is nice to have for the warmer evenings, to blow around the lovely warm air.
